Its the same process for Windows 7 & Windows 8.

 

Download the Windows 7 ISO

Create a bootable USB key: http://blog.powerbiz.net.au/fixes/using-diskpart-to-create-a-bootable-usb-of-windows-8/

Boot off the USB key

Do a clean install. This will give you the option to delete the partition/drive.

Create a new partition, install
